Odisha: Class 9 tribal student 'gangraped' by BSF jawans in Koraput, claims family

A class nine tribal student was allegedly gangraped by four men wearing camouflage uniforms on Tuesday, who the victim’s brother alleged to be jawans of Border Security Force (BSF) engaged in anti-Naxal operations.
Koraput superintendent of police (SP) Kanwar Vishal Singh, “The victim in her statement had said that her perpetrators were in uniform.”
He added, “We have registered a case at Pottangi police station.”
However, the BSF deputy inspector general (DIG), denied the involvement of any paramilitary jawans in the case.
According to the rape survivor’s brother, the victim was returning from Musuliguda village in the district after registering her biometrics for Aadhar card.
He added that jawans intercepted her near Kunulihaata area and took her to a nearby forest where she the BSF jawans allegedly took turns to rape the minor.
He added that his sister was rescued by a relative who later admitted her to a hospital.
Nayak denying involvement of BSF men in the alleged rape case of minor said, “Our nearest camp is 35 kilometers from the reported site. BSF does not operate in that area.”
The victim stated to be critical is undergoing treatment in Koraput district hospital.
